Sally Jean Golfman passed away peacefully on March 2, 2026, surrounded by the love of her family. She was 77 years old. Born on July 18, 1948, in Hinton, WV, she was a daughter of the late Leonard and Erma Criddle Taylor. On May 25, 1990, she married Randy Golfman, and he survives her passing. Sally worked as a dispatcher at Northern Kentucky University before retiring as Center Manager of the Pendleton County Senior Center. It was there that she truly left her mark, building lasting friendships and serving her community with compassion and dedication. She also gave generously of her time through volunteer work with CERT, RSVP, Search & Rescue, and other organizations close to her heart. Sally's kindness, strength, and servant's heart will be deeply missed and lovingly remembered by all who knew her. Sally loved to take her crew to the casinos, work puzzles, and play Euchre. She enjoyed spending time at the beach and was an animal lover. She and Randy had a special love for their dogs.

Sally is lovingly remembered by her devoted husband, Randy Wayne Golfman; her brother, John S. Taylor (Jean); her daughter, Renee McKinney (Hugh); her son, Shawn Hayslette (Beekee); and her stepsons, Ron Golfman (Lonnya) and Doug Golfman (John). She was a proud grandmother to Derick and Justin Fleshman, Cameron "Alex" Stracener (Gracie) and Coty Stracener; Logan and Keegan Hayslette; Becka White (Quinton) and Katie Burke (Greg) and a cherished great-grandmother to many.

In addition to her parents, Leonard Ray "Bill" and Erma Jean Criddle Taylor, she was preceded in death by her brothers, James W. "Jake" Taylor and Ronald Ray Taylor.

A memorial service will be held on Friday, March 6, 2026, at 2:00 P.M. at Woodhead Funeral Home in Falmouth with Bro. Evan Williams officiating. A memorial gathering will take place from 12-2 preceding the service.

Memorial contributions are suggested to the Pendleton County Animal Shelter: 1314 Bryan Griffin Rd, Butler, KY 41006
